What companies run services between Merate, Italy and Cesenatico, Italy?

You can take a train from Cernusco-Merate to Cesenatico via Monza, Milano Centrale, Bologna Centrale, Cesena, and Cesena in around 5h 8m. Alternatively, FlixBus operates a bus from Milan to Rimini once daily. Tickets cost €27–40 and the journey takes 4h 25m.
